About Team

The IPF Digital Acquisition Feature Team manages the end-to-end lifecycle of customer onboarding, user acquisition funnels, and digital lending journeys - including brands such as Creditea and Credit24. The team shapes frictionless acquisition paths while balancing risk and conversion goals.

Working closely with UX designers, credit risk managers, and engineering teams, we focus on building scalable and data-driven solutions that improve customer experience and drive sustainable growth. The team plays a key role in shaping how new customers discover, apply for, and access our lending products across multiple markets.

We work in an Agile environment alongside cross-functional teams, focusing on collaboration, adaptability, and continuous improvement - always looking for smarter ways to deliver value, improve processes, and strengthen our products.

This role is based in Poland, with responsibility for initiatives across all IPF Digital operations and markets.

Here’s how you’ll put your skills into action

  • You’ll identify and recommend effective business process solutions in the finance area, considering integrations with other systems and domains.

  • You will capture and present different perspectives, including those of the customer, business, processes, risks, and technology.

  • You’ll conduct end-to-end process analysis from the frontend, through the backend, to integrations with other systems and teams.

  • You’ll use strong analytical skills to uncover real business needs and propose alternative solutions.

  • You’ll focus on delivering real value to both users and the business, while avoiding unnecessary complexity and being able to define an MVP.

  • You’ll collaborate with IT & business representatives and moderate meetings in a structured and effective way.

  • You’ll gather and document functional and non-functional requirements, ensuring clarity and traceability.

  • You’ll decompose epics into stories or tasks, organize them, and ensure product and feature descriptions are easily understandable for developers and testers.

  • You’ll apply advanced analysis techniques such as functional decomposition, user stories, use cases & scenarios, user story mapping, process and system modeling (BPMN, UML), and visual thinking.

  • You’ll support two development teams simultaneously, efficiently closing open points and switching between multiple initiatives.

  • You’ll communicate fluently in English, both verbally and in writing, to collaborate effectively across international teams.

  • You’ll demonstrate a proactive, disciplined, and delivery-focused mindset, able to work independently and drive results.

We also know that experience counts – and we believe that the following can support your success

  • At least 4 years of experience as a IT Business Analyst, preferably within the financial or banking industry,

  • Experience with quering databases with SQL basics to validate assumptions or extract insights.

  • Familiarity with Atlassian tools like JIRA and Confluence to manage analysis and documentation efficiently.

About Visma

Visma is a leading provider of mission-critical business software, with revenue of € 2.8 billion in 2024 and 2.2 million customers across Europe and Latin America.

By simplifying and automating the work of SMBs and the public sector, we help unleash the power of digitalization and AI across our societies and economies.
